Overview

Bank Frick allows you to grant access to your accounts by creating a authorised agent. This is done through Bank Frick Online Banking, where you can:
  • add a new user with their own login credentials
  • choose which accounts they can access
  • define what they are allowed to see and do, such as viewing balances or initiating payments
You will be setting up a user that can securely access account data and initiate transactions without sharing your primary login.
